What is Litchfield Minerals Shares Buyback Ratio %?

Litchfield Minerals ASX:LMS 6 Shares Buyback Ratio % is -80.06 as of Aug. 07, 2026. GuruFocus rates ASX:LMS with a GF Score™ of 6/100. The stock has 1 warning sign investors should review.

Shares Outstanding (EOP) are shares that have been authorized, issued, and purchased by investors and are held by them.

GuruFocus calculates shares buyback ratio using previous shares outstanding minus the current shares outstanding, and then divides by previous shares outstanding. Litchfield Minerals's current shares buyback ratio was -80.06%.

Litchfield Minerals Shares Buyback Ratio % Calculation

Litchfield Minerals's Shares Buyback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as

Shares Buyback Ratio=(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jun. 2024 ) -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jun. 2025 )) /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jun. 2024 )
=(35.404 - 36.239) / 35.404
=-2.36%

Litchfield Minerals's Shares Buyback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Shares Buyback Ratio=(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jun. 2025 ) -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Dec. 2025 )) /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jun. 2025 )
=(36.239 - 63.750) / 36.239
=-75.92%

Litchfield Minerals Business Description

Other Exchanges ZC9:Germany
Address 10 Market Street, Suite 5, Level 12, Brisbane, QLD, AUS, 4000
Litchfield Minerals Ltd is a mining company engaged in the exploration and evaluation of mineral properties in Australia. The company's main focus is on exploring copper, tungsten, rare earth elements, uranium, and gold. Its primary project is the Mount Doreen Project. Some of its other projects include Oonagalabi, Lucy Creek, Paradise Well, Silver Valley, and Others.
